Skip to content

Штрихкодирование общего назначения ИСМП клиент сервер

ЗаполнитьПараметрыСканирования

Описание, пример вызова
// Заполняет параметры сканирования по контексту.
//
// Параметры:
// Контекст - ФормаКлиентскогоПриложения, ДокументСсылка - источник заполнения параметров сканирования
// ВидПродукции - ПеречислениеСсылка.ВидыПродукцииИС - по данному параметру будет проиходить отбор заполнения
// ПараметрыСканирования - См. ШтрихкодированиеОбщегоНазначенияИСКлиент.ПараметрыСканирования
// ПараметрыРежимаИсправленияОшибок - Структура - Параметры режима исправления ошибок
Процедура ЗаполнитьПараметрыСканирования(Контекст, ВидПродукции, ПараметрыСканирования, ПараметрыРежимаИсправленияОшибок = Неопределено) Экспорт

Пример вызова

ШтрихкодированиеОбщегоНазначенияИСМПКлиентСервер.ЗаполнитьПараметрыСканирования(Контекст, ВидПродукции, ПараметрыСканирования, ПараметрыРежимаИсправленияОшибок);

ДополнитьПараметрамиСканированияИСМП

Описание, пример вызова
Процедура ДополнитьПараметрамиСканированияИСМП(ПараметрыСканирования) Экспорт

Пример вызова

ШтрихкодированиеОбщегоНазначенияИСМПКлиентСервер.ДополнитьПараметрамиСканированияИСМП(ПараметрыСканирования)

НовыйЭлементДанныхПроверкиСредствамиККТ

Описание, пример вызова
// Конструктор элемента данных для проверки кода маркировки средствами ККТ.
//
// Возвращаемое значение:
// Структура - Новый элемент данных проверки средствами ККТ:
// * КодМаркировки - Строка - код маркировки.
// * ПолныйКодМаркировки - Строка - полный код маркировки.
// * ВидПродукции - ПеречислениеСсылка.ВидыПродукцииИС - вид продукции
// * ПланируемыйСтатусТовара - ПеречислениеСсылка.ПланируемыйСтатусМаркируемогоТовара - планируемый статус.
// * ВидПродукции - ПеречислениеСсылка.ВидыПродукцииИС - вид продукции.
// * ВидУпаковки - ПеречислениеСсылка.ВидыУпаковокИС - вид упаковки.
// * ШтрихкодУпаковки - Неопределено, ОпределяемыйТип.ШтрихкодУпаковкиИС - ссылка на штрихкод, используется в сценариях сохранения результатов проверки.
// * ПредставлениеНоменклатуры - Строка, Неопределено - представление позиции для отображения пользователю. Если не заполнено - будет определяться по ШтрихкодУпаковки.
// * ПолученРезультатЗапросаКМ - Булево - Служебный. Для блокировки повторного оповещения.
// * ТекстОшибки - Строка, Неопределено - текст ошибки распределения.
// * Количество - Число - количество штук или иной мере (вес, объем и.т.д.).
// * ЧастичноеВыбытиеКоличество - Число, Неопределено - числитель частичного выбытия.
// * ЕмкостьПотребительскойУпаковки - Число, Неопределено - знаменатель частичного выбытия.
// * КодЕдиницыИзмерения - Строка, Неопределено - код единицы измерения частично выбытия
// * КоличествоПотребительскихУпаковок - Число - Количество потребительских упаковок
// * РазрешительныйРежимИдентификаторЗапросаГИСМТ - ОпределяемыйТип.УникальныйИдентификаторИС - идентификатор запроса ГИС МТ
// * РазрешительныйРежимДатаЗапросаГИСМТ - Строка - дата получения идентификатора ГИС МТ в формате timestamp
// * РазрешительныйРежимАдресСервера - Строка - адрес сервера разрешительного запроса
// * РазрешительныйРежимТелоЗапросаJSON - Строка - тело разрешительного запроса
// * РазрешительныйРежимТелоОтветаJSON - Строка - тело ответа разрешительного запроса
// * РазрешительныйРежимКодОтвета - Строка - код ответа разрешительного запроса
// * ЧастичноеВыбытиеОстаток - Неопределено, Число - остаток во вскрытой потребительской упаковке
// * ЧастичноеВыбытиеКомментарий - Неопределено, Строка - комментарий к вскрытой потребительской упаковке
Функция НовыйЭлементДанныхПроверкиСредствамиККТ() Экспорт

Пример вызова

Результат = ШтрихкодированиеОбщегоНазначенияИСМПКлиентСервер.НовыйЭлементДанныхПроверкиСредствамиККТ()

© 2024, ООО 1С-Софт
Все права защищены. Эта программа и сопроводительные материалы предоставляются
в соответствии с условиями лицензии Attribution 4.0 International (CC BY 4.0).